My Sister Missed Her Flight

My sister missed her flight yesterday by a few minutes. That was a lesson for both of us. For my sister, she should buy her pasalubong, earlier. Me--I've learned that Cebu Pacific in GenSan has the least accommodating staff at the check-in area. I've flown PAL several times but I didn't have the same experience my sister went through yesterday.

Since she had to go back to work on Monday, she had book another flight that could take her back to Manila the soonest time possible. She took the plane from Davao and had to pay more new fees like booking fee, reissue fee, no-show fee, and fare difference. That's a lesson learned the hard way.

I told her to be at the airport two hours before the flight though the counter closes 45 minutes the flight.

I'm going to Dumaguete at the end of this month and I bet we're taking Cebu Pacific, so I have to keep this in mind.
